Sander de Smalen ce40cc53f3 Match types of accumulator and result for llvm.experimental.vector.reduce.fadd/fmul
The scalar start/accumulator value of the fadd- and fmul reduction
should match the result type of the reduction, as well as the vector
element-type of the input vector. Although this was not explicitly
specified in the LangRef, it was taken for granted in code implementing
the reductions. The patch also fixes the LangRef by adding this
constraint.

//===- IRBuilder.cpp - Builder for LLVM Instrs ----------------------------===//
//
// Part of the LLVM Project, under the Apache License v2.0 with LLVM Exceptions.
// See https://llvm.org/LICENSE.txt for license information.
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
//
// This file implements the IRBuilder class, which is used as a convenient way
// to create LLVM instructions with a consistent and simplified interface.
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
#include "llvm/IR/IRBuilder.h"
#include "llvm/ADT/ArrayRef.h"
#include "llvm/ADT/None.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Constant.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Constants.h"
#include "llvm/IR/DerivedTypes.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Function.h"
#include "llvm/IR/GlobalValue.h"
#include "llvm/IR/GlobalVariable.h"
#include "llvm/IR/IntrinsicInst.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Intrinsics.h"
#include "llvm/IR/LLVMContext.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Operator.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Statepoint.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Type.h"
#include "llvm/IR/Value.h"
#include "llvm/Support/Casting.h"
#include "llvm/Support/MathExtras.h"
#include <cassert>
#include <cstdint>
#include <vector>
using namespace llvm;
/// CreateGlobalString - Make a new global variable with an initializer that
/// has array of i8 type filled in with the nul terminated string value
/// specified. If Name is specified, it is the name of the global variable
/// created.
GlobalVariable *IRBuilderBase::CreateGlobalString(StringRef Str,
const Twine &Name,
unsigned AddressSpace) {
Constant *StrConstant = ConstantDataArray::getString(Context, Str);
Module &M = *BB->getParent()->getParent();
auto *GV = new GlobalVariable(M, StrConstant->getType(), true,
GlobalValue::PrivateLinkage, StrConstant, Name,
nullptr, GlobalVariable::NotThreadLocal,
AddressSpace);
GV->setUnnamedAddr(GlobalValue::UnnamedAddr::Global);
GV->setAlignment(1);
return GV;
}

/// Create a call to a Masked Load intrinsic.
/// \p Ptr - base pointer for the load
/// \p Align - alignment of the source location
/// \p Mask - vector of booleans which indicates what vector lanes should
/// be accessed in memory
/// \p PassThru - pass-through value that is used to fill the masked-off lanes
/// of the result
/// \p Name - name of the result variable
CallInst *IRBuilderBase::CreateMaskedLoad(Value *Ptr, unsigned Align,
Value *Mask, Value *PassThru,
const Twine &Name) {
auto *PtrTy = cast<PointerType>(Ptr->getType());
Type *DataTy = PtrTy->getElementType();
assert(DataTy->isVectorTy() && "Ptr should point to a vector");
assert(Mask && "Mask should not be all-ones (null)");
if (!PassThru)
PassThru = UndefValue::get(DataTy);
Type *OverloadedTypes[] = { DataTy, PtrTy };
Value *Ops[] = { Ptr, getInt32(Align), Mask, PassThru};
return CreateMaskedIntrinsic(Intrinsic::masked_load, Ops,
OverloadedTypes, Name);
}
/// Create a call to a Masked Store intrinsic.
/// \p Val - data to be stored,
/// \p Ptr - base pointer for the store
/// \p Align - alignment of the destination location
/// \p Mask - vector of booleans which indicates what vector lanes should
/// be accessed in memory
CallInst *IRBuilderBase::CreateMaskedStore(Value *Val, Value *Ptr,
unsigned Align, Value *Mask) {
auto *PtrTy = cast<PointerType>(Ptr->getType());
Type *DataTy = PtrTy->getElementType();
assert(DataTy->isVectorTy() && "Ptr should point to a vector");
assert(Mask && "Mask should not be all-ones (null)");
Type *OverloadedTypes[] = { DataTy, PtrTy };
Value *Ops[] = { Val, Ptr, getInt32(Align), Mask };
return CreateMaskedIntrinsic(Intrinsic::masked_store, Ops, OverloadedTypes);
}
/// Create a call to a Masked intrinsic, with given intrinsic Id,
/// an array of operands - Ops, and an array of overloaded types -
/// OverloadedTypes.
CallInst *IRBuilderBase::CreateMaskedIntrinsic(Intrinsic::ID Id,
ArrayRef<Value *> Ops,
ArrayRef<Type *> OverloadedTypes,
const Twine &Name) {
Module *M = BB->getParent()->getParent();
Function *TheFn = Intrinsic::getDeclaration(M, Id, OverloadedTypes);
return createCallHelper(TheFn, Ops, this, Name);
}
/// Create a call to a Masked Gather intrinsic.
/// \p Ptrs - vector of pointers for loading
/// \p Align - alignment for one element
/// \p Mask - vector of booleans which indicates what vector lanes should
/// be accessed in memory
/// \p PassThru - pass-through value that is used to fill the masked-off lanes
/// of the result
/// \p Name - name of the result variable
CallInst *IRBuilderBase::CreateMaskedGather(Value *Ptrs, unsigned Align,
Value *Mask, Value *PassThru,
const Twine& Name) {
auto PtrsTy = cast<VectorType>(Ptrs->getType());
auto PtrTy = cast<PointerType>(PtrsTy->getElementType());
unsigned NumElts = PtrsTy->getVectorNumElements();
Type *DataTy = VectorType::get(PtrTy->getElementType(), NumElts);
if (!Mask)
Mask = Constant::getAllOnesValue(VectorType::get(Type::getInt1Ty(Context),
NumElts));
if (!PassThru)
PassThru = UndefValue::get(DataTy);
Type *OverloadedTypes[] = {DataTy, PtrsTy};
Value * Ops[] = {Ptrs, getInt32(Align), Mask, PassThru};
// We specify only one type when we create this intrinsic. Types of other
// arguments are derived from this type.
return CreateMaskedIntrinsic(Intrinsic::masked_gather, Ops, OverloadedTypes,
Name);
}
/// Create a call to a Masked Scatter intrinsic.
/// \p Data - data to be stored,
/// \p Ptrs - the vector of pointers, where the \p Data elements should be
/// stored
/// \p Align - alignment for one element
/// \p Mask - vector of booleans which indicates what vector lanes should
/// be accessed in memory
CallInst *IRBuilderBase::CreateMaskedScatter(Value *Data, Value *Ptrs,
unsigned Align, Value *Mask) {
auto PtrsTy = cast<VectorType>(Ptrs->getType());
auto DataTy = cast<VectorType>(Data->getType());
unsigned NumElts = PtrsTy->getVectorNumElements();
#ifndef NDEBUG
auto PtrTy = cast<PointerType>(PtrsTy->getElementType());
assert(NumElts == DataTy->getVectorNumElements() &&
PtrTy->getElementType() == DataTy->getElementType() &&
"Incompatible pointer and data types");
#endif
if (!Mask)
Mask = Constant::getAllOnesValue(VectorType::get(Type::getInt1Ty(Context),
NumElts));
Type *OverloadedTypes[] = {DataTy, PtrsTy};
Value * Ops[] = {Data, Ptrs, getInt32(Align), Mask};
// We specify only one type when we create this intrinsic. Types of other
// arguments are derived from this type.
return CreateMaskedIntrinsic(Intrinsic::masked_scatter, Ops, OverloadedTypes);
}
